Develop a Comprehensive Cleansing List



Producing a thorough cleansing checklist can make your Airbnb turn over process smoother and much more efficient. Start by detailing all areas in your room, consisting of bed rooms, bathrooms, cooking area, and living locations. Damage down each area right into particular jobs. As an example, in the kitchen, consist of cleaning down kitchen counters, cleansing home appliances, and washing dishes.


Do not fail to remember the information-- look for dirt on surfaces, tidy mirrors, and vacuum cleaner carpetings. Consist of washing tasks like transforming bed linens and towels, as fresh bed linens can leave an enduring perception.


By following this list, you'll enhance your cleansing procedure, reduce stress, and guarantee your guests show up to a pristine environment. And also, a tidy home enhances guest satisfaction and encourages favorable evaluations, which is essential for your Airbnb success.

Make Use Of the Right Cleaning Products



After dealing with the high-traffic locations, it's time to assess the cleansing items you use. Picking the best cleaning materials can make all the difference in attaining a clean area that wows your visitors. Start by picking all-purpose cleansers that are efficient on numerous surface areas, saving you time and initiative. Seek eco-friendly alternatives to interest environmentally mindful visitors; they'll appreciate your commitment to sustainability.


Do not neglect concerning disinfectants-- especially in bathrooms and kitchen areas. Make sure they're EPA-approved for maximum performance versus bacteria. Microfiber towels are essential for dusting and wiping down surface areas given that they catch dirt without scraping.


For floorings, find a cleaner suitable for your floor covering type, whether it's floor tile, wood, or laminate. Lastly, consider adding a positive scent with air fresheners or vital oils, as a fresh-smelling area enhances the total experience. Your selection of items can absolutely raise your Airbnb's tidiness and setting.

Exactly how Often Should I Deep Tidy My Airbnb Property?



You should deep clean your Airbnb building at least when a month. If you have high turn over or animals, think about doing it extra regularly. Routine deep cleaning maintains your room fresh and welcoming for guests.


What Are Eco-Friendly Cleansing Product Options?



When you're selecting green cleansing items, take into consideration options like vinegar, baking soda, and castile soap. They're effective, safe for your visitors, and much better for the environment. You'll be astonished at their cleaning power!


Exactly How Can I Handle Cleaning After a Pet Dog Stay?



After an animal keep, vacuum cleaner thoroughly to get rid of hair, use enzyme cleaners for discolorations, and wash all linens. Don't neglect to air out the room and check for any remaining smells to guarantee freshness.
